World Games is a sort of Olympic Games for non Olympic sports, and is arranged every 4th year with around 5000 participants and a lot of sports. When World Games was arranged in Duisburg in 2005 I did well, and won a bronze medal on the Middle distance, behind Thierry Gueorgiou and Daniel Hubmann.
